Holland America Line to introduce Morimoto By Sea sushi bar

Sunday, Mar 02, 2025 0

 

Holland America Line is expanding its Morimoto By Sea dining experience with a new specialty sushi bar.

 

The intimate 12-guest venue will feature a menu created by the cruise line’s Global Fresh Fish Ambassador, chef Masaharu Morimoto, offering a selection of signature sushi, sashimi, rolls and smaller dishes.

 

The Morimoto By Sea sushi bar will be introduced on Rotterdam, Koningsdam, Nieuw Statendam and Eurodam, from March through to June 2025. It is also available on Nieuw Amsterdam, which introduced the sushi bar with a Morimoto By Sea stand-alone restaurant in 2023.

 

Items on the Morimoto By Sea sushi bar menu, available beginning in March 2025, include:

 

Appetiser delights to start

 

* Toto tartare: wasabi, nori paste, sour cream and chives

 

Sushi and sashimi selections

 

* Chef’s combination: Sushi sashimi

* Nigiri and Sashimi: seasonal white fish, maguro tuna, sake salmon, hamachi yellowtail, kampachi amberjack, unagi freshwater eel, hotate scallop, ebi shrimp, tako octopus, Ikura salmon roe, otoro fatty tuna and cutoro medium fatty tuna.

 

Chef’s signature sushi rolls

 

* Shrimp tempura: California roll, tempura shrimp and gochujang aioli

* Lobster tempura: tempura lobster, avocado, romaine lettuce, tobiko, cucumber and scallion

* Tako yaki: tempura octopus, cabbage, tonkatsu sauce, mayo and bonito flakes

* Aburi salmon: salmon avocado roll and spicy mayo, torched

* California: snow crab, cucumber and avocado

* Spicy tuna: tuna, scallion and spicy sauce

* Spicy salmon: salmon, scallion and spicy sauce

 

Additional signature plates

 

* Tuna pizza: anchovy aioli, kalamata olives, red onion and jalapeno

* Sticky ribs: hoisin sweet chili sauce and cilantro

* Pork gyoza dumplings: with scallion ginger sauce

* Poke bowl: marinated fresh fish, cucumber, avocado, seaweed and rice

* Chicken katsu curry: panko crusted chicken breast, Japanese curry sauce and rice

* Angry lobster pad Thai: Maine lobster, rice noodles and Thai red curry sauce

 

Dessert

 

* White chocolate lime ganache: coconut foam, mango yuzu sorbet and rice pudding

 

Morimoto By Sea is part of Holland America Line’s Global Fresh Fish programme, which features locally sourced fresh fish, from port to plate in less than 48 hours, offering more than 80 varieties of fresh fish from across a worldwide network.

 

In addition to the Morimoto By Sea sushi bar, chef Morimoto’s first restaurant at sea, Morimoto By Sea, is available on Nieuw Amsterdam and as a pop-up experience at least once per cruise on all other ships.

 

Michael Stendebach, vice president of food, beverage and rooms division for Holland America Line, said: “With chef Morimoto’s knowledge and expertise in the sushi world, it made sense for him to expand beyond his Morimoto By Sea restaurant and develop a specialised sushi bar featuring his signature style and flavours. We’re excited to extend our fresh fish options and give our guests access to another specialty venue with cuisine by such a renowned chef.”

 

Morimoto By Sea sushi bar, which will be located in the former Nami Sushi venue, is an a la carte menu offered for a surcharge. Reservations can be made pre-cruise or once onboard.
